Before the weekly eng sync, please review how we drive synthetic traffic against the Cartwheel staging checkout. Our load generator, Stampede, replays anonymized order shapes at configurable concurrency via `STAMPEDE_VUS` and `STAMPEDE_RAMP_SECONDS`. Keep ramps under 300 seconds in staging to avoid tripping the payment sandbox's rate limiter. Stampede authenticates to the checkout gateway with a service credential that must never be committed; it is injected from the env file, where it appears on the line directly below.

vault entry, yahif-yajep: COURIER_KEY29=b802bdf8034096b65a51c6ba5abe2

# Artifact Signing & the Flaky DNS Saga

Quick note for whoever's running releases this week. The signing service for Quillbox artifacts sometimes times out because the internal resolver intermittently drops lookups for the signing host — classic flaky DNS, not an outage. If verification hangs, retry twice before paging anyone; it almost always clears. We've pinned the resolver on the release box as a stopgap while the network folks investigate. Once you can reach the signing host, sign the artifact with the release key below.

rollout seal: bky4_DFM9

Ticket: Color-contrast audit — Bramblewick dashboard

Priority: Medium

The quarterly accessibility audit flagged eleven components in the Bramblewick dashboard failing the 4.5:1 contrast ratio, mostly muted labels on the status cards. For new team members: our tokens live in the theme package, so fix values there, not inline. Each fix needs a before/after screenshot attached. Audit run reference follows below.

pipeline stamp: htk6_7941f2

Subject: Handover — Crashfall pipeline

Taking over Crashfall crash-report ingestion for the Pebblekit mobile app as of Monday. For your review: symbol uploads are signed at build time, reports are verified on intake, and unverified payloads are quarantined in the Dredge bucket for 14 days. Rotation cadence is quarterly; last rotation completed two weeks ago by the Tallow release crew. No open incidents. Everything you need is in the runbook except the key itself, which follows here.

signing key of bagap-yawep = bky13_TbfT6ZMUoGJo2